The Global CNTs Conductive Paste Market was valued at USD 380 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 620 million by 2030, growing at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 8.5% during the forecast period (2024–2030). This growth is driven by surging demand from battery manufacturers and electronics producers seeking superior conductivity solutions.

As industries transition from traditional conductive materials to nanotechnology-based alternatives, carbon nanotube (CNT) pastes are becoming the material of choice for lithium-ion batteries, flexible electronics, and advanced energy storage systems. 🔟 1. OCSiAl

Headquarters: Luxembourg
Key Offering: Graphene nanotube conductive pastes

OCSiAl dominates the single-wall carbon nanotube market with patented production technology that delivers superior conductivity at low loading levels. Their TUBALL™ matrix is revolutionizing battery performance.

Innovation Highlights:

  • 90% global market share in single-wall nanotubes

  • Partnerships with leading battery manufacturers

  • Production capacity of 75+ tons annually

9️⃣ 2. Nanocyl

Headquarters: Sambreville, Belgium
Key Offering: Industrial-grade CNT conductive pastes

Nanocyl’s NC7000™ series sets industry benchmarks for multi-wall carbon nanotube dispersions, with applications ranging from automotive batteries to aerospace composites.

Innovation Highlights:

  • ISO 9001 certified production facilities

  • Focus on automotive electrification solutions


8️⃣ 3. Cnano Technology

Headquarters: Jiangsu, China
Key Offering: CNT paste for lithium-ion batteries

Cnano Technology has become China’s largest CNT paste producer through vertical integration from raw materials to finished products, serving major battery manufacturers.

Innovation Highlights:

  • Annual capacity exceeding 5,000 tons

  • Strategic partnerships with CATL and BYD


7️⃣ 4. Meijo Nano Carbon

Headquarters: Nagoya, Japan
Key Offering: Specialty CNT pastes

Japanese precision meets nanotechnology in Meijo’s conductive pastes, which are favored by high-end electronics manufacturers for their purity and consistency.

Innovation Highlights:

  • Proprietary dispersion technology

  • Focus on silicon anode applications

6️⃣ 5. Shenzhen Jinbaina Nanotechnology

Headquarters: Shenzhen, China
Key Offering: Cost-effective MWCNT pastes

Jinbaina has carved a niche in China’s massive battery market by offering quality multi-wall CNT pastes at competitive price points without compromising performance.

Innovation Highlights:

  • Rapid scale-up capabilities

  • Special formulations for power batteries


5️⃣ 6. Shenzhen Dynanonic

Headquarters: Shenzhen, China
Key Offering: High-performance conductive additives

Dynanonic focuses on next-generation battery materials, supplying conductive pastes to China’s booming EV battery industry.

Innovation Highlights:

  • R&D collaborations with major institutes

  • High-volume production capabilities


4️⃣ 7. Shenzhen Nanotech Port

Headquarters: Shenzhen, China
Key Offering: Flexible electronics solutions

Specializing in conductive materials for consumer electronics, Nanotech Port develops CNT pastes optimized for flexible displays and wearables.

Innovation Highlights:

  • Low-temperature curing formulations

  • Stretchable conductor technology


3️⃣ 8. Miller-Stephenson

Headquarters: Danbury, USA
Key Offering: High-purity conductive pastes

With over 60 years in specialty chemicals, Miller-Stephenson brings proven expertise to high-performance CNT formulations for aerospace and defense applications.

Innovation Highlights:

  • Military-grade specifications

  • Custom formulation services


2️⃣ 9. Novarials Corporation

Headquarters: Massachusetts, USA
Key Offering: Printable CNT inks

Novarials pioneers environmentally friendly CNT formulations for printed electronics, enabling new manufacturing approaches for flexible circuits.

Innovation Highlights:

  • Water-based formulations

  • Compatible with various printing methods


1️⃣ 10. Susnzk

Headquarters: Suzhou, China
Key Offering: Hybrid nanocomposites

Susnzk differentiates itself by combining CNTs with graphene and other nanomaterials to create conductive pastes with enhanced properties for specialized applications.

Innovation Highlights:

  • Custom composite development

  • Thermal management solutions

🌍 Outlook: The CNT Conductive Paste Revolution

The CNT conductive paste market stands at an inflection point as demand grows exponentially from multiple industries. These advanced materials are enabling breakthroughs in energy density, flexibility, and manufacturing efficiency.

📈 Key Market Drivers:

  • EV battery performance requirements

  • Silicon anode adoption in batteries

  • Growth in printed/flexible electronics

  • Replacement of traditional conductive additives
